M BISWAS Advocate for the Respondent : PP, ASSAM, Page No.# 2/3 BEFORE H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E PARTHIVJYOTI SAIKIA ORDER Date : 11.05.2026 1. Heard Mr. M. Biswas, learned counsel for the petitioner. Also heard Mr. K. K. Das, learned Additional Public Prosecutor for the State of Assam. 2. This is an application under Section 482 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, 2023, whereby the petitioner Nichel Tayung @ Nikhil Tayung has prayed for pre-arrest bail in respect of Dergaon P.S. Case No.61/2026, under Section 69 of the BNS, 2023. 3. The petitioner was maintaining a relationship with a girl and both of them were also engaged in a physical relationship. On 02.04.2026, they travelled together on a motorcycle. After some time, an argument arose between them over an undisclosed issue, and out of anger, the petitioner abandoned the girl along with the motorcycle on the road. 4. Mr. Das, learned Additional Public Prosecutor has objected to this bail application. 5. I have considered the submissions made by the learned counsel for both sides. 6. This Court is of the opinion that for the allegation brought against the petitioner, he does not deserve to be detained in custody. Therefore, his pre-arrest bail application is allowed. Page No.# 3/3 7. It is hereby directed that in the event of arrest in connection with Dergaon P.S. Case No.61/2026, the petitioner Nichel Tayung @ Nikhil Tayung shall be released on bail of Rs.20,000/- with a surety of like amount to the satisfaction of the arresting authority. 8. The petitioner shall co-operate with the Police Investigating Officer as and when called for. 9. With the aforesaid direction, this pre-arrest bail application stands disposed of.
